I picked up several of Rimmel's newest line back in February, so they're not that new anymore! My first choice to try was Marine Blue, and I have to say, I'm rather impressed with their latest line.


I have quite a few older Rimmel polishes, and these new ones seem far superior with regard to the formula. The application (2 coats) was very nice, and the coverage on this one was perfect. It has the Sally Hansen-type brush cut and wide, flat stem, only Rimmel seems to have a better quality control department inspecting these than Sally does. Like Sally Hansen's, the bottle opening is very small, and mark my words, one of these days I'm going to tip a bottle over that's designed with such a small opening! I love the shape of these bottles--they're heavy and substantial, and the square shape fits nicely into the rows of my collection (take note, Nicole by OPI!). This shade is a lovely medium turquoise shimmer with very fine particles that flash a lighter blue-green shade. I picked mine up at Walgreen's for $3.99, and although these are slightly smaller than average at .45 fl. oz., if they're all as nice as this one, then I'd have to say that they're a great value.
